Provide suggestions and opinions about the procedures for providing services and the ways of developing them.
Provide doctors at all the licensing sections to examine the driving license applicants and ensure their fitness. The department provides offices, phones and the necessary devices.
Provide representatives at the licensing sections to discharge the drivers and the vehicles from the traffic violations. The licensing department provides offices, communication devices and the communication lines for the computers.
Exchange information about drivers and the vehicles and pass the insurance contracts by the certified insurance companies at the kingdom to cover the civil liability from damage against others caused by using those vehicles as stipulated in traffic law no (49) 2008.
Participate in holding courses and workshops regarding the environment protection. And participate in field campaigns to examine the exhaust emissions from vehicles.
Provide trained and qualified staffs to activate and operate all the necessary computer systems to license the vehicles and drivers and to improve them if needed, in addition to provide all the necessary hardware and software. The department also provides the required infrastructure and the administrative services.
Consider the traffic violations cases incurred by the drivers and the vehicles issued by the municipality court and other municipalities courts. It is also considering the cases which require other legal actions regarding vehicles and drivers (seizure and suspended license etc.…). The license department implements the court decisions in this regard.
Continuous coordination between the department and the training driving centers in terms of providing the certificates of competency for the driving licenses applicants after their qualifying and training classes prescribed by the instructions of driving training centers issued by the traffic law no (49) 2008. The constant coordination with these centers in order to improve the training process by merging these centers and enhance its services to meet the specifications of the 1st class training centers.
Consists of clearing the sold cars for the first time (new cars) and provide the department with the customs data to document them in the vehicles file to ensure the owners rights. There are also permanent joint committees with customs department regarding the duty-free cars for disabled persons.
